LT1492CN8#PBF belongs to the category of integrated circuits (ICs).
This product is commonly used in electronic devices for signal amplification and conditioning.
LT1492CN8#PBF is available in an 8-pin plastic DIP (Dual Inline Package) package.
The essence of LT1492CN8#PBF lies in its ability to amplify and condition signals with low power consumption and high performance.

LT1492CN8#PBF operates based on the principles of operational amplifiers. It amplifies the difference between the voltages at its inputs, producing an output voltage that is a multiple of this difference. The device uses internal circuitry to achieve low power consumption, high input impedance, and other desired characteristics.
LT1492CN8#PBF finds applications in various fields, including but not limited to: - Audio amplification circuits - Sensor signal conditioning - Active filters - Data acquisition systems - Battery-powered devices
Some alternative models similar to LT1492CN8#PBF are: - LM358 - TL072 - AD822
These alternatives offer similar functionality and can be used as replacements depending on specific requirements.
